This is a production role required for the assembly and production of our laser systems.
PRIMARY DUTIES & RESPONSIBILITIES:
- Assembly and test of production products, including optic/laser alignment, fault diagnosis; result monitoring and analysis.
- Final optical assembly of advanced laser products.
- Optical alignment and test of advanced laser products.
- Laser set up using sophisticated optical techniques.
- Laser calibration using electronic control.
- Improve laser build documentation.
EDUCATION & EXPERIENCE:
- Degree or equivalent in a laser science or related subject or equivalent knowledge gained through working in a laser production environment.
- Experience of aligning and testing opto-electronic/laser equipment.
- Strong innovation, analytical and diagnostic skills.
- Knowledge and experience of quality control/process improvement methods.
- Excellent communication skills, in particular verbal skills to keep team up to date with progress.
- Ability to work as part of a team.
- Able to work to deadlines.
